1 : Visit Zentrum Paul Klee Museum [2 hrs]
Explore the fascinating museum dedicated to the works of artist Paul Klee, showcasing a vast collection of paintings, drawings, and artifacts. Learn about the life and artistic journey of this influential Swiss painter in a modern and architecturally stunning building.
2 : Discover the enchanting Nydegg Church [1 hr]
Admire the beautiful architecture of Nydegg Church, a historic landmark located in the heart of Koniz. Take in the serene atmosphere inside the church, featuring intricate stained glass windows and ornate decorations.
3 : Explore the Bernisches Historisches Museum [2 hrs]
Immerse yourself in the rich history of Bern and Switzerland at the Bernisches Historisches Museum. Marvel at the extensive collection of artifacts, archaeological finds, and exhibits spanning from prehistoric times to the modern era.
4 : Stroll through Rosengarten [1.5 hrs]
Relax in the picturesque Rosengarten, a rose garden with panoramic views overlooking the city of Bern. Enjoy a leisurely walk among the blooming flowers, sculptures, and fountains while taking in the breathtaking scenery.
5 : Visit the Tierpark Dahlholzli [1.5 hrs]
Spend time at the Tierpark Dahlholzli, a charming zoo featuring a variety of animals including bears, monkeys, and exotic birds. Explore the different habitats and learn about conservation efforts while enjoying a family-friendly outing.
Background Info
Weather
Koniz experiences a temperate climate with cool summers and cold winters. Average temperatures range from 0°C to 24°C. Rainfall is spread throughout the year, with the highest precipitation in the summer months. Humidity levels are moderate, and the air quality is generally good.
Language
The local language spoken in Koniz is Swiss Standard German, a variant of the German language with some regional differences in vocabulary and pronunciation.

Köniz – municipality in the canton of Bern in Switzerland
Location: Koniz, Bern , Switzerland
Official Site: Visit Official Site
Summary: Köniz Summary
Map: Map of Köniz
Weather: Köniz Forecast
Post Codes: 3084, 3095, 3097, 3098, 3144, 3145, 3147, 3172, 3173, 3174
Dialing Codes: 031
Official Languages: German
Official Names: Köniz (Swiss High German)
Population: 39,375 (2012)
Elevation: 572 m
Area: 51.1 sq km
Coordinates: 46.925, 7.415
Timezone: (UTC+01:00) Central European Time (Zurich)
